标签: image visual-c++
我有一些bitmaps,我想将它们保存到一个图像中,列和行中有一定数量的图像。我怎么做?
答案 0 :(得分:0)
创建一个总大小的位图。依次加载每个源位图,将其blit到组合位图中的适当位置。保存组合的位图。
保存复合材料可能是这些步骤中最繁琐的工作(您需要创建并填写BITMAPFILEHEADER后跟BITMAPINFOHEADER,BITMAPV4HEADER或BITMAPV5HEADER)但是没有一个特别困难,谷歌应该提出很多例子。
BITMAPFILEHEADER
BITMAPINFOHEADER
BITMAPV4HEADER
BITMAPV5HEADER